Architectural Proportions and Scale
One of the most overlooked aspects of exterior design is proportion. The relationship between windows, doors, rooflines, walls, and decorative elements significantly influences how balanced a home appears. Poor proportions can make even expensive homes feel awkward or disconnected.
Architects carefully evaluate dimensions and relationships between structural elements to create visual harmony. Proper scale ensures that every feature feels appropriately sized and contributes to a cohesive composition. This attention to detail is often what distinguishes professionally designed homes from standard construction.

How Does Exterior Architecture Influence Functionality?
Improving Energy Efficiency
Exterior design affects more than appearance. It also plays a significant role in energy performance. Window placement, roof overhangs, building orientation, and material selection can influence heating and cooling efficiency throughout the year.
Architects analyze environmental conditions and site characteristics to develop designs that support energy conservation. Strategic planning can help maximize natural light while reducing excessive heat gain or energy loss. These decisions contribute to a more comfortable and efficient living environment.

Addressing Site Specific Conditions
Every property presents unique opportunities and challenges. Factors such as lot dimensions, topography, sunlight exposure, surrounding structures, and local regulations all influence design decisions. Custom architectural solutions allow homeowners to take full advantage of these conditions rather than relying on generic approaches.
Professional architects evaluate the site comprehensively before developing design concepts. This process helps ensure the home responds appropriately to its environment while maximizing both visual and functional benefits.
